Appointment of Sheronie James needs to be explained

Dear Editor,

The sudden resignation of Sheronie James, Deputy Head at SOCU ostensibly for reasons linked to her failure to produce her qualifications is shocking. However, I have noticed with alarm how easily Guyanese are sold on the idea of foreign intervention and foreigners as well intentioned and acting in our best interests.  Only the naïve can believe this to be so.  We need to be far more questioning, more analytical and perhaps more cynical when we open our doors to foreign aid no matter how friendly and benign they may appear to be.

That brings me to the larger issue.  Why was Ms. James appointed to such a senior position if she did not possess the requisite qualifications?  Minister Ramjattan and the British High Commissioner owe the people of Guyana an explanation and when they offer that explanation they should also explain the role of Sam Sittlington, another British import.
